What are the button functions of the Volkswagen T-Cross?
1 Answers
The button functions of the Volkswagen T-Cross are: 1. The buttons on the left side of the steering wheel control the adaptive cruise, including speed adjustment buttons, clear button, set button, and resume button; 2. The buttons on the right side of the steering wheel control the central display screen, wireless receiver phone, and volume. Taking the 2021 Volkswagen T-Cross as an example, it is a compact SUV with body dimensions of: length 4218mm, width 1760mm, height 1599mm, and a wheelbase of 2651mm. The 2021 Volkswagen T-Cross features a front MacPherson strut independent suspension and a rear torsion beam non-independent suspension, with a front-wheel drive configuration.
